CFWS members Linda Brant, Vera Gubnitskaia, Teresa Chin, and Julie Nieves will be featured in the upcoming exhibit called “ELEGY FOR THE UNSEEN: The art of Extinct Species”, located in the Fusion Gallery at the Orlando Science Center. The show will be exhibited from August 28 through November 15, 2026 .
The exhibition spans approximately 600 million years of Earth’s biological history. Biologists estimate that more than 99% of all species that have ever lived are now extinct, representing over five billion species throughout Earth’s history.

Resurrection biology, also known as de-extinction, is branch of science that seeks to create living proxies of extinct species using technologies such as ancient DNA analysis, genome editing, and back breeding. Ancient DNA is recovered by carefully drilling or grinding a small sample from exceptionally well-preserved bones or teeth. Researchers isolate the fragmented genetic material in specialized laboratories, then use advanced DNA sequencing techniques to reconstruct portions of the extinct animal’s genome. By comparing these ancient genetic sequences with those of modern species, scientists can better understand the evolutionary history of a particular species and identify key genetic traits of their wild ancestors. Science is actively exploring de-extinction research involving several iconic extinct species, including the woolly mammoth, dodo, Tasmanian tiger (thylacine), passenger pigeon, and aurochs. These efforts are expanding our understanding of genetics, evolution, and conservation biology, and may one day contribute to restoring lost ecological functions or strengthening the resilience of endangered living species.

Ammonites were marine animals related to squid and octopus. They appeared on Earth about 410 million years ago. They had a spiral external shell divided into chambers and a soft internal body inside the shell. Their known size range was from 0.5” to over 7 feet in diameter. Ammonites fed on plankton, vegetation, and slow moving or dead marine animals. Ammonites went completely extinct about 66 million years ago.
